Unlike conventional driveways, block pave drives in Trowbridge are placed on top of the earth, necessitating a sub-base of roughly 230mm. Crushed stones of Type 1 are layered on top of sharp sand to create this sub-base. With no movement or puddles, this sub-base makes the driveway incredibly stable. Limestone and other minerals make up MOT Type 1, a crushed granular aggregate.

Choosing a block-paved driveway over a concrete driveway has a number of benefits. The ability to customise your driveway layout and paving pattern using block paving is one of its main advantages. There are only a few different designs available when using concrete. The fact that you can select from a wide variety of colours and designs is another benefit of block paving. Alternatively, you can go for a more traditional or modern look.

Concrete block pavement has a green design as a major benefit as well. Given that it is constructed from recycled materials, further drainage is not required. Concrete block pavement has the drawback that UV exposure causes it to fade over time. A block paving sealer, however, can stop this colour shift if you use it frequently. The cost of labour also varies based on the difficulty of the project in addition to block paving. For example, more money will be spent on intricate laying patterns than on natural, organic forms. The time needed by a paver to execute the project should also be taken into account. Your location inside the UK will affect the cost of labour as well. To give one example, the cost of labour will be higher in London than in the Midlands or the North West.

Bricks or cobbles are additional terms for clay paving blocks. Although there are several shapes possible, they are typically rectangular bricks. The exterior of a structure can be covered with clay pavers, which come in natural colours. Usually, walls and pillars are constructed out of this material. A corrugated or curved face can be found on Type D clay paving blocks. When paved in any pattern, these paver stones lock into place.
